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5047807489 6231 975179571 9797
22337605641 9694 68736327693
22337605641 9694 68736327693
801 306 9338246050
All about undefined
Interested in learning more?
22337605641 9694 68736327693
801 306 9338246050
See more
2202710 91578
14 30307262 25649306
See more
713605511 29445447961 61787
9038 511783 6560 51264
See more